[英]Is java -version telling me about the JRE or the JDK?
我只有一個 JRE,現在我還下載了一個 JDK; 它們在控制面板中列為:
Java 8 update 121
, Java SE Development Kit 8 Update 121
所以我猜我的JDK里面的JRE和其他JRE是同一個版本;
當我在 cmd java -version 中寫入時; 它是原始jre還是jdk文件夾中的jre?
我也在想,考慮到我有 2 個相同的 JRE,我可以刪除舊的還是不好的做法?
它與你道路上的第一件事有關,就這么簡單。 每個可執行文件都遵循相同的解析規則。
在 unix 上,您可以使用它來查看它的來源
which java
在 Windows 它是
where java
java -version
告訴 JDK 版本,是的,您應該只在系統中保留 JRE 和 JDK 的最新生產版本。 無需擁有多個庫,因為任何應用程序都只能有一個與之關聯的 JRE。
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.